## Options and Configurations
### Accessing the Options Page
To access the options page for the Qodo Merge Chrome extension:
1. Find the extension icon in your Chrome toolbar (usually in the top-right corner of your browser)
2. Right-click on the extension icon
3. Select "Options" from the context menu that appears
Alternatively, you can access the options page directly using this URL:
[chrome-extension://ephlnjeghhogofkifjloamocljapahnl/options.html](chrome-extension://ephlnjeghhogofkifjloamocljapahnl/options.html)

### Configuration Options

#### API Base Host
For single-tenant customers, you can configure the extension to communicate directly with your company's Qodo Merge server instance.
To set this up:
- Enter your organization's Qodo Merge API endpoint in the "API Base Host" field
- This endpoint should be provided by your Qodo DevOps Team
*Note: The extension does not send your code to the server, but only triggers your previously installed Qodo Merge application.*
#### Interface Options
You can customize the extension's interface by:
- Toggling the "Show Qodo Merge Toolbar" option
- When disabled, the toolbar will not appear in your Github comment bar
Remember to click "Save Settings" after making any changes.
